    To be honest, I don't trust them at all after the fiasco of dealing with proheart6.  At the hearing on jan. 31, 2005 for the FDA to decide if it was safe to be brought back to the market, Banfield was there and testified that NO DOG RECIEVING PROHEART 6 AT ANY OF THEIR CLINICS HAD HAD A REACTION/DEATH.  But I was in contact with some whose dogs DID HAVE A REACTION, DID DIE, IT WAS REPORTED TO BANFIELD.  They were most upset to learn that Banfield had claimed no reactions.no deaths when they had reported it to Banfield.
     
     
    ETA  But this is difrerent, there is no way they can be sued, and they don't have a money insterest in it like they did with having people coming in to get PH6 injections.
